A fiber wall socket (also called an optical termination outlet or FTTH outlet) is the critical endpoint where your home's fiber optic cable connects to the Optical Network Terminal (ONT). It ensures a clean, stable interface between the ISP's fiber network and your router—impacting speed, latency. How is Socket Fiber installed? Drop install: We run fiber from the street to your home and install an ONT (connection box) on the outside of your house. You don't need to be home for this.
